
Cell Phone Covers
The use of electronic equipment in the industry and private sector is nowadays very widespread. This in turn increases the safety risks to and by equipment, caused by electromagnetic and electro-static fields. The amount of interferences produced by equipment and its immunity to interferences is strictly regulated. In general any equipment in a plastic housing (e. g. cell phone) can only meet this immunity level if its housing is metallically conductive (Faraday cage). For this kind of shielding application Atotech's Covertron® electroless copper and nickel process is perfectly suited offering excellent corrosion protection.
Cell Phone Cover Application - Typical Process Sequence with Recommended Products (Shielding Application)
Substrate | >> ABS/PC |
|---|---|
Etching | >> Covertron Sweller or Cr Etch |
Conditioning | >> Covertron Conditioner |
Pre Dip | >> H2SO4 |
Activation | >> Covertron Activation |
Accelerator | >> Covertron Reducer |
E'less Cu Plating | >> Covertron Cu |
E'less Ni Plating | >> Covertron Ni |
